These recipes all start with the humble bell pepper, then fill it with a mix of meats, grains, sauces, and more to create meals that are both hearty and flexible. From classic beef-based fillings to lighter, plant-forward options and even a pizza-inspired twist, stuffed peppers get reimagined in all kinds of fun ways. Whether baked, slow-cooked, or made in an air fryer, these dishes bring big flavor packed into a colorful, edible shell. They’re great for weeknight meals, meal prep, or even themed dinners.

Stuffed Peppers

Stuffed Peppers. Photo credit: Southern Food and Fun.

Classic stuffed peppers are filled with a savory mix of ground beef, rice, tomato sauce, and seasoning. The peppers soften in the oven while the filling gets rich and tender. Melted cheese on top adds extra flavor. Serve with a side of salad or bread.

Vegan Stuffed Peppers

A red bell pepper half stuffed with quinoa, mushrooms, lentils, and chopped herbs, served on a white plate—a delicious addition to your favorite stuffed pepper recipes.
Vegan Stuffed Peppers. Photo credit: Urban Farmie.

These meatless peppers are packed with grains, vegetables, and beans for a filling plant-based option. The flavors blend well with herbs and a tomato-based sauce. They bake until the peppers are tender and the filling is warmed through. You can easily make extra and freeze for later.

Instant Pot Stuffed Pepper Soup

Low angle shot of stuffed pepper soup in a white bowl.
Instant Pot Stuffed Pepper Soup. Photo credit: All Ways Delicious.

This soup version brings together all the stuffed pepper ingredients in a comforting broth. The Instant Pot makes it fast and simple. Ground meat, peppers, rice, and tomatoes cook into a thick, flavorful soup. Serve with crusty bread for dipping.
